Specifications
Series: Stratix® V GX
Part Status: Active
Number of LABs/CLBs: 234720
Number of Logic Elements/Cells: 622000
Total RAM Bits: 59939840
Number of I/O: 552
Voltage - Supply: 0.82 V ~ 0.88 V
Mounting Type: Surface Mount
Operating Temperature: -40°C ~ 100°C (TJ)
Package / Case: 1152-BBGA, FCBGA
Supplier Device Package: 1152-FBGA (35x35)
Base Part Number: 5SGXEA7

FPGAs, or Field Programmable Gate Arrays, are semiconductor devices that are widely used in embedded systems. For example, 5SGXEA7H2F35I3L is an FPGA from Altera/Intel Corporation, which is one of the most popular FPGAs in the embedded market. It is used in many embedded applications such as personal computers, automotive electronics, mobile phones, and industrial control equipment.

The core of an FPGA is made up of two components: logic blocks and interconnect. The logic blocks are the parts that contain the actual logic circuits, while the interconnect is the component that connects the logic blocks and configures them into the desired circuit. This means that an FPGA can be programmed to perform a variety of functions depending on the configuration of the components.

One of the major advantages of an FPGA is its efficient use of physical space. FPGAs are designed to fit into a very small area, which is particularly useful for compact embedded systems. It also provides more flexibility in terms of component selection, as the FPGA can be customized to meet the requirements of the application in a much shorter time than a standard application-specific integrated circuit (ASIC) can.

Another advantage of an FPGA is its ability to be programmed in software. This allows for the application’s functionality to be changed quickly and easily without having to make any hardware changes. This makes FPGAs ideal for applications that need to be quickly adapted to changing market trends or customer needs. For example, an FPGA can be used to quickly and easily implement a communications protocol that was not previously available in the device.

An FPGA also has the ability to incorporate a wide variety of peripherals, such as memory devices and communications controllers, which gives it more flexibility than an ASIC. Additionally, FPGAs have a high degree of programmability, allowing for the implementation of complex functions that would otherwise be too complex or memory-intensive to be implemented in an ASIC.

FPGAs are used in a variety of embedded applications, ranging from communications and industrial systems to medical and consumer applications. Their ability to be programmed and reconfigured quickly make them an ideal solution for many different types of applications.
